Review

The experiences of residents and their families at Altercare of Hartville Center for Senior Living reveal a complex tapestry of care that ranges from commendable to concerning. While some individuals highlight the dedication and professionalism demonstrated by the physical and occupational therapists, others voice significant dissatisfaction with various aspects of care, administration, and overall environment.

Many reviewers praise the nursing staff for being responsive and accommodating, especially in the context of rehabilitation after surgeries such as hip and knee replacements or treatment for conditions like cellulitis. Family members express appreciation for how staff actively listened to concerns, maintained friendly interactions, and worked diligently to help loved ones meet their rehabilitation goals. One reviewer noted that despite their husband being a resident on multiple occasions, they never encountered unpleasant experiences during his stays. This sentiment reflects a consistent positive interaction with nursing staff, contributing to an overall favorable impression from certain families.

However, contrasting opinions emerge regarding the broader spectrum of care provided at Altercare. A common theme is the reliance on agency nurses who may not be familiar with individual residents. This lack of continuity can lead to gaps in care, as one family recounted their struggles when visiting every day felt necessary to ensure adequate attention was given to their loved one. They voiced frustration over changes made by the house doctor to medication without thorough communication or oversight. Such issues underscore concerns about administrative support during critical times when personalized care is vital.

Billing practices have also emerged as a central concern among some reviewers. Instances where families faced legal action due to billing discrepancies cast a shadow over what could otherwise be viewed positively about Altercare’s services. One individual stated that despite having both Medicare and private insurance coverage for additional costs, there was a failure on the facility's part to bill adequately. The aftermath resulted in unwanted court cases and financial stress that tainted what should have been a straightforward process during an already challenging time.

While many concur that physical therapy services are exceptional, there are alarming reviews regarding medical attention rates within the facility itself. One grieving family member recounted how their father developed severe bedsores due to inadequate medical oversight during his stay at Altercare before he was seen by a doctor associated with their insurance provider. Such narratives spotlights deficits in necessary medical attention which can lead to dire consequences for vulnerable residents who often rely heavily on facility staff for health management.

Environmental factors also play a critical role in forming impressions about Altercare's suitability for long-term residence or rehabilitation stays. Some reviews lamented poorly maintained living conditions characterized by lackluster rooms devoid of basic amenities like televisions or proper decor—elements crucial for fostering comfort among senior residents competing against feelings of isolation or neglect in sterile surroundings. The atmosphere described suggests potential deterioration in residents’ mental health due solely to uninviting settings marked by inattentive staff who are perceived as insensitive or indifferent toward patient well-being.

In summary, while several aspects of care at Altercare of Hartville Center resonate positively—primarily therapeutic interventions—the testimonies also illuminate substantial areas needing improvement particularly surrounding medical oversight, environmental quality, reliable staffing practices, and transparent billing procedures. Description

Altercare of Hartville Center in Hartville, OH is a premier assisted living community that offers a wide range of amenities and care services to ensure the comfort and well-being of its residents.

The community features a beauty salon where residents can indulge in pampering treatments, as well as cable or satellite TV in each resident's room for their entertainment. Community operated transportation is available for outings and appointments, and there is also a computer center for residents to stay connected with their loved ones.

Dining at Altercare of Hartville Center is a delightful experience with restaurant-style dining in the elegant dining room. Special dietary restrictions are taken into consideration to accommodate individual needs. There is also a kitchenette available for residents who prefer cooking their own meals.

The community provides various recreational options to keep residents engaged and active. There is a fitness room equipped with exercise equipment, as well as a gaming room for fun leisure activities. Residents can also enjoy the beautiful outdoor space and garden for relaxation or socializing. A small library is available for book lovers to immerse themselves in reading, while Wi-Fi/high-speed internet ensures connectivity throughout the community.

Care services at Altercare of Hartville Center are top-notch, with 24-hour call system and supervision provided by dedicated staff members. Assistance with daily living activities such as bathing, dressing, transfers, and medication management are readily available. The community also offers diabetes diet management and special dietary restrictions to cater to individual health needs.

Residents have access to various amenities nearby including 2 cafes, 4 parks, 9 pharmacies, 2 physicians' offices, 5 restaurants, transportation options, and places of worship within close proximity.
